Abstract

Background: Wound is a discontinuity or damage in part of human tissue. The uses of traditional medicine for the treatment of wound were still commonly found in especially indonesia. One of the tradisional medicine is Cromolaena Odorata. Chromolaena odonarata may promote wound healing and also increases collagen expression. Povidone iodine was currently the standard treatment for wound and has an antiseptic effect.

Aim: To understand the comparison of the effectivity of Chromolaena odonarata and Povione iodine 10% to collagen density in incision wound in white mice (Sprague dawley).

Method: This is an experimental study with 4 groups which were the control group (P1) which was treated with Povidone iodine 10% and comparison group

(P1,P2,P3) which was treated chromolaena odorata 10%,15% dan 20%. Collagen density was measured under the microscope using Nagaoka criteria. Data was analyzed using Kruskall Wallis analysis.

Result: The result of this study was p value of p=0.609 (>0.05).

Conclusion: The use of Chromolaena odonarata leaf extract and povidone iodine 10% did not showed any significant difference of effectivity in prior to collagen density in incision wound in white mice from Sprague dawley strain.
